The Easee app allows users to have complete control over their chargers from any location, ensuring accessibility at all times. The charging robot provided by Easee remains connected through Wifi and built-in 4G, guaranteeing seamless operation.
By utilizing the Easee app, users gain valuable insight into their charging habits, such as monthly charging expenses, current power consumption, and battery top-ups for electric vehicles (EVs). Additionally, users can monitor power distribution across phases and track the charger's status and connected car information.
Enhanced security features include options to control access to the charging robot using key tags and secure the cable to prevent theft. Users can rest assured that their charging cable remains safe even when not in use.
Users can prevent fuse overloads by limiting the charging power of their chargers directly from the Easee app, ensuring a stable power supply at all times.
Further customization options are available through the app, allowing users to personalize the charging station's appearance with five different front cover colors. Users can tailor the app interface to match their preferences, creating a seamless and elegant home charging solution.

Pros
- User-friendly interface for both installation and operation.
- Supports multiple EV charging standards, making it versatile for various electric vehicles.
- Compact design allows for easy installation in tight spaces.
- Real-time monitoring of charging status through a mobile app.
- Can be integrated with home energy management systems to optimize energy use.
- Over-the-air software updates ensure the device stays updated.
- Robust safety features to prevent overheating and overcurrent.
Cons
- Higher initial cost compared to some other EV chargers.
- Installation may require professional assistance, leading to additional expenses.
- Reliance on Wi-Fi for some features may limit functionality in areas with poor connectivity.
- Limited features without a subscription to premium services within the mobile app.
